What is A2 Steel?

A2 steel is a tool steel known for its toughness and wear resistance. It contains chromium, molybdenum, and vanadium, which contribute to its excellent edge retention. A2 steel is also relatively easy to sharpen, making it a favorite among users who value performance and durability.

What is LC200N Steel?

LC200N steel, on the other hand, is a nitrogen-based alloy that is highly corrosion-resistant. It is often used in marine environments due to its ability to withstand rust and pitting. LC200N is also known for its toughness and edge retention, making it a versatile choice for outdoor enthusiasts.

Comparing Performance

When it comes to performance, A2 steel excels in toughness and wear resistance. It can handle heavy-duty tasks without chipping or breaking, making it ideal for hard use. On the other hand, LC200N steel shines in corrosion resistance, making it perfect for humid or saltwater environments where rust is a concern.

Edge Retention

Both A2 and LC200N steel offer excellent edge retention, but they achieve it through different mechanisms. A2 steel relies on its hardness and wear resistance to maintain a sharp edge, while LC200N's nitrogen content enhances its edge retention without sacrificing toughness.

Maintenance

When it comes to maintenance, A2 steel requires regular care to prevent corrosion. It is essential to keep A2 blades clean and dry to avoid rust. On the other hand, LC200N steel is virtually maintenance-free, thanks to its high corrosion resistance. Simply rinse the blade with fresh water after use, and you're good to go.
